Assertion (A): Constructive interference occurs when the waves from two coherent sources meet in phase at a point. | Reason (R): The intensity at the point of constructive interference is four times the intensity of each individual source.
Both A and R are true and R is the correct explanation of A.
Both A and R are true but R is not the correct explanation of A.
A is true but R is false.
A is false but R is true.
Correct Answer
Detailed Explanation
Both statements are true. Constructive interference happens when waves arrive in phase, and the intensity is four times that of an individual source, as the amplitude doubles, leading to intensity being quadrupled (since intensity is proportional to amplitude squared).
